For immunoblotting of yeast S. cerevisiae whole-cell lysates, cells were cultured and lysates were prepared as previously described in SDS loading buffer28 (link). Proteins were resolved by SDS-PAGE and blotted using affinity-purified guinea pig anti-Gle1 (ASW 4310 (link)), rabbit anti-GFP (Thermo Fisher Scientific, Waltham, MA), or anti-yPgk1 (Thermo Fisher Scientific). IRDye 800CW-conjugated goat anti-mouse (LI-COR, Lincoln, NE) or Alexa Fluor 700 goat anti-rabbit (Thermo Fisher Scientific) antibodies (1:5000) were visualized with the Li-Cor Odyssey scanner (Lincoln, NE).
For HeLa cell lysate immunoblotting, cells were grown in 60 mm dishes (Fisher Scientific, Pittsburg, PA) and lysed in RIPA buffer (Sigma, St. Louis, MO) supplemented with EDTA-free cOmplete protease inhibitor cocktail (Roche Applied Science, Indianapolis, IN). Proteins were resolved by SDS-PAGE and blotted with rat anti-mCherry (Sigma), anti-hNup42/NUPL2 (Sigma), mouse anti-beta-actin (Sigma), or anti-hGle117 (link) antibodies. Infrared 700- or 800-conjugated secondary antibodies (Thermo Fisher Scientific) were visualized with the Li-Cor Odyssey scanner.
